Methacryloyloxyethyl phosphorylcholine (MPC), containing a phosphorylcholine group in the side chain is a most suitable monomer to mimic the phospholipid polar groups contained with cell membranes. MPC block copolymers are biocompatible in nature; it shows desirable interaction with living tissues. It is hydroscopic in nature. Uses: Mpc block copolymers with styrene are biocompatible in nature. In enzymology, a glycerophosphocholine phosphodiesterase (EC 3.1.4.2) is an enzyme that catalyzes the chemical reaction: sn-glycero-3-phosphocholine + H2O<-> choline + sn-glycerol 3-phosphate. Thus, the two substrates of this enzyme are sn-glycero-3-phosphocholine and H2O, whereas its two products are choline and sn-glycerol 3-phosphate. Zotarolimus (also known as ABT-578) is an analogue of rapamycin (sirolimus) that was designed to have a shorter in vivo half-life than rapamycin. Zotarolimus was found to be comparable in potency for inhibiting in vitro proliferation of both rat and human T cells and mechanistically similar to sirolimus in having high-affinity binding to the immunophilin FKBP12. Zotarolimus is a semi-synthetic derivative of rapamycin. It was designed for use in stents with phosphorylcholine as a carrier. Group: Biochemicals.
